Abstract :
In recent years, distributed generations (DG) interconnected to power distribution system increase in order to cope with global environment problems in Japan. We are worried that it is difficult to control system voltage in power distribution system. We study about influence of DG to conventional operation and control of power distribution system and develop operation method by using control function of DG and distribution system. Moreover, we are worried that system voltage rise by capacitors of middle voltage customers to improve power factor (pf) and it is necessary to request capacity of capacitor become suitable and capacitors are open at light load. Under this circumstance, we cannot estimate this influence in detail because we don´t have the analysis tool that can model voltage control by distribution system, power factor control by customer and voltage control function of DG. In this paper, we develop the analysis tool “CALDG” by using graphical user interface that can model voltage control by distribution system, pf control by customer and voltage control function of DGs.
